Because consumers might require their help any time during the day, locksmiths may function uneven hours in a variety of locations and weather condition problems. Educating to end up being a locksmith professional commonly entails a combination of classroom knowing and hands-on experience. There are several locksmithing colleges and training programs located across the country that provide both in-person and on the internet programs.


To get added hands-on experience, many locksmiths complete an instruction or job as a student with an experienced locksmith. Not all locksmith professionals want to handle trainees or pupils, however several are. An apprentice might execute tasks around the workplace or go out into the field with a seasoned locksmith professional.

Numerous states need locksmith professionals to obtain a license to practice their profession, and volunteer certification can show clients that a locksmith has met high criteria for training and experience. In some states, locksmith professionals are required just to pass a criminal history background check, yet in others, locksmith professionals must finish an accepted training program and pass a licensing exam.


To get an apprentice license, one may need to pass a criminal history background check. There are usually no licensing assessments to pass at this stage, however apprentice applicants need to reveal that they are used by a certified locksmith professional. Along with their license, locksmiths can pursue voluntary accreditations. Associated Locksmiths of America supplies certifications for locksmiths at various levels of expertise.




Apprenticeships normally last a couple of years. The average yearly spend for locksmith professionals in the United States was $37,560 in 2012. Locksmith trainees and pupils often begin at base pay, and if they are productive, their income will enhance from there. The Bureau of Labor Stats jobs that work of locksmiths will grow 7 percent between 2012 and 2020, slower than the average growth for all line of work.
